Job Description

The Project Coordinator plays an important supporting role in helping client marketing programs move smoothly from kickoff through final delivery. Working closely with Account Executives, Project Managers, and cross-functional teams, you'll assist with day-to-day project coordination, keeping timelines on track, teams aligned, and work moving efficiently through the agency. This is an entry-level role designed to provide hands-on exposure to all facets of agency operations, including Account Service, creative, strategy, production, and operations. We're looking for someone who is curious, highly organized, detail-oriented, and genuinely excited to grow a career in project management and agency life. In addition to supporting client work, this role may also contribute to internal agency initiatives, special projects, and FARM's own marketing and social media efforts.

What You'll Do
  • Support the coordination of integrated marketing projects from kickoff through final delivery.
  • Assist in building and maintaining project timelines, schedules, task lists, and status updates.
  • Track project progress and help communicate deadlines, deliverables, and next steps to internal teams.
  • Partner with Account Executives, Project Managers, creatives, and other departments to ensure projects move efficiently through workflows.
  • Attend project meetings, take notes and action items, and follow up on outstanding tasks.
  • Support budget tracking, estimate updates, and project documentation as needed.
  • Help identify scheduling conflicts or project risks and escalate concerns to senior team members when appropriate.
  • Contribute ideas and support process improvements that strengthen team collaboration and operational efficiency
What You'll Bring
  • Bachelor's degree in marketing, communications, business, advertising, or a related field preferred.
  • Internship, campus leadership, volunteer, freelance, or class project experience demonstrating organization, collaboration, or project coordination skills is a plus.
  • Strong organ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ple tasks, deadlines, and priorities in a fast-paced environment.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with a collaborative and professional approach to working with teams.
  • A proactive mindset, strong attention to detail, and a willingness to learn and contribute across different areas of the agency.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office; familiarity with project management or collaboration tools is a plus
